Family Law Considerations
Family law matters in Coppell encompass divorce, child custody, child support, and adoption, all governed by Texas Family Code. Coppell residents often engage with the Dallas County Family Court, which applies state guidelines but also considers local judicial preferences. Legal representation must address sensitive issues such as community property division under Texas law, which presumes equal ownership of assets acquired during marriage.
Child custody disputes require careful attention to the best interest of the child standard, a principle rigorously applied in local courts. Legal professionals must be adept at negotiating parenting plans and modifications, often involving mediation as a prerequisite before court hearings. Understanding local resources and support systems enhances the ability to advocate effectively for clients in Coppell.

Personal Injury Claims
Personal injury cases in Coppell involve claims arising from accidents, negligence, or intentional harm. Texas law imposes specific statutes of limitations and damage caps that vary by claim type, necessitating prompt legal action. Coppell residents typically file claims in Dallas County civil courts, where local procedural rules impact case management and settlement negotiations.
Legal representation in personal injury matters includes thorough investigation, medical documentation review, and negotiation with insurance companies. Attorneys must also consider Texas comparative fault rules, which can reduce recoverable damages if the injured party is partially responsible for the incident.

Probate and Estate Issues
Probate matters in Coppell are administered through Dallas County Probate Courts, which oversee the validation of wills, estate administration, and guardianship appointments. Texas Estates Code provides the statutory framework, but local court rules influence filing procedures and hearing schedules.
Legal counsel must guide clients through the probate process, including inventorying assets, notifying heirs, and resolving creditor claims. Estate planning services often involve drafting wills, trusts, and powers of attorney tailored to Texas law and local considerations.
